Let's take a stroll through the most typical-- however hugely varied-- product choices that a flat roofing professional might suggest:

  • Built-Up Roofing (BUR): Picture layers of tar, felt, and gravel stacked like a fortress. This timeless technique uses robust protection, but it's the weight and intricacy that frequently shock house owners.
  • Customized Bitumen: Think About this as the nimble cousin of BUR-- versatile, simple to set up, and enhanced with polymers for additional strength. It's a preferred in places where temperature level swings are the standard.
  • EPDM Rubber: Pronounced "E-P-D-M," this artificial rubber membrane behaves like a streamlined, black shield. It's waterproof, UV-resistant, and typically the go-to for those looking for sturdiness with a touch of simplicity.
  • Thermoplastic Membranes (TPO, PVC): These intense, reflective membranes are the solar warriors of flat roof. Their heat-reflective properties can decrease cooling expenses, making them an environmentally friendly champ.
  • Spray Polyurethane Foam (SPF): Photo a foam that expands and seals every nook and cranny of your roofing, developing an airtight fortress versus leaks. It's lightweight but needs professional application.

Setup Methods for Flat Roofs Ever observed how a flat roofing system can deceptively appear simple? Beneath its apparently straightforward surface area lies a complicated

dance of waterproofing, materials, and accuracy. One misstep in installation, and you're staring at puddles, leaks, or even worse-- structural damage. The secret? Mastering the art of proper drainage slope even when the roof looks flat. A typical misconception is that flat roofing systems are completely horizontal; in truth, they need a subtle slope-- normally around 1/4 inch per foot-- to coax water away effectively. Take for instance a task where the installer disregarded this subtlety. Within months, water pooled stubbornly, causing premature membrane failure. Those who set up flat roofing systems expertly never avoid the step of producing these mild slopes utilizing tapered insulation or crickets around drains. It's not almost laying materials-- it's about assisting water's journey. Key Installation Steps to bear in mind Surface Preparation: Make sure the substrate is tidy, dry, and structurally noise. Any debris or wetness can undermine adhesion. Membrane Choice and Placement: Pick a proper membrane

  1. with meticulous attention to seams and edges. Seam Sealing: Usage hot-air welding or adhesive techniques particular to the membrane type to produce watertight seams.
  2. Even a tiny gap can welcome failure. Flashing Installation: Protect vulnerable areas such as parapets, vents, and skylights with custom-flashed barriers. Think about flashing as the roofing system's armor.
  3. Drain Pipes Combination: Correctly set up and seal drains pipes to avoid backflow and standing water. Did you understand that ecological elements like UV direct exposure and temperature level swings can trigger membranegrowth and contraction? Expert flat roofing professionals expect this by incorporating expansion joints or versatile adhesives to accommodate movement. Disregarding this can result in fractures and eventual leakages. Pro Tips from the Field Constantly utilize a chalk line or laser level to validate slopes before membrane setup

. Apply a primer suitable with the membrane to boost adhesion on permeable substrates. In colder climates, permit materials to adjust to ambient temperature level to prevent brittleness. Seal all penetrations diligently-- pipeline boots and vents are the most typical weak areas. Test the roof post-installation by flooding little locations with water to examine for unintended pooling. Necessary Flat Roofing System Maintenance Tips Routine Examinations: Arrange comprehensive checks after heavy rain or snow. Look for blisters, cracks, and pooling water. Clear Debris: Leaves and dirt might appear safe but can block drains and cause water to stagnate. Sealant Refresh: Use high-quality sealants periodically to preserve water resistant integrity. Drain Optimization: Guarantee drains and ambushes are unblocked and appropriately angled. Repair Flat Roof Benson MD. UV Security: Use finishes that show UV rays, minimizing material tiredness. When Repair Work Becomes Urgent Picture spotting a bulge on your flat roofing system. That's not simply a cosmetic defect; it's caught wetness expanding below the membrane

. Ignoring it can cause blister rupture

  • and leakages. Immediate patching with compatible materials is crucial here. A typical novice error is using mismatched repair compounds that fail to bond, welcoming further decay. Benson, Maryland, is a small community located in Harford County in the northeastern part of the state. Geographically, Benson is located at approximately 39.5918° N latitude and 76.2898° W longitude. The community lies near the intersection of Maryland Route 22 and Maryland Route 543, providing convenient access to nearby towns and cities such as Bel Air, the county seat of Harford County, about 5 miles south, and Aberdeen, located roughly 7 miles east. This closeness to major routes and urban centers makes Benson a prime location for residents and businesses. Benson is part of the Harford County Public Schools district, serving families in the area with access to excellent education. The population of Benson, while not officially recorded as a separate census-designated place, is estimated to be a tight-knit community that benefits from the rural suburban blend typical of Harford County. The demographic profile of the broader region includes a median household income of approximately $95,000 and a population density of around 300 people per square mile, reflecting a moderately populated area with a mix of residential and agricultural land use. Points of interest near Benson include the Harford County Agricultural Center, which hosts fairs and community events, and the nearby Susquehanna State Park, a 2,700-acre park offering outdoor recreational activities such as hiking, fishing, and boating along the Susquehanna River. Historical sites in the area include the Rockfield Manor and the historic district of Bel Air, which showcases colonial and Victorian architecture. Benson’s elevation is approximately 320 feet above sea level, contributing to its slightly rolling terrain. The community experiences a humid subtropical climate with four distinct seasons, average annual temperatures ranging from 25°F in winter to 85°F in summer, and average annual precipitation around 43 inches, supporting diverse local flora and agriculture.
